Hi Marco
the one thought that comes to mind is to search the string looking for
QUOTE
D Quote c Const('''')
Then substring the string out and re-format it to something like this
c eval Sqlstatement = Stringpart01 + Quote +
c Stringpart02 + Quote +
Stringpart03

I'm having a problem with SQLRPGLE that I don't how to fix.
We currently use embedded SQL:
C/exec sql
C+ PREPARE S1 FROM :W_STRING
C/end-exec
C/exec sql
C+ DECLARE CURS1 CURSOR FOR S1
C/end-exec
C/exec sql
C+ OPEN CURS1
C/end-exec
and then FETCH ...
The problem is that sometimes users put apostrophe "'" inside the search
arguments and the prepare statement fails (i.e Regent's).
Must be easy but I don't how to handle it.
